What is the difference between MSCs and exosomes for anti-aging?
MSCs are living cells that engraft, secrete growth factors, and directly interact with damaged tissue. Exosomes are nano-sized vesicles produced by MSCs that carry regenerative RNA and proteins. Our program combines both: MSCs for systemic regeneration and exosomes for enhanced cell signalling and targeted aesthetic applications.
